Smooth Jazz: The Sound of Elegance and Relaxation
Smooth jazz is a refined and soothing genre that emerged in the late 1970s and early 1980s, blending jazz elements with R&B, pop, and soul influences. Characterized by its mellow tones, polished production, and emphasis on instrumental melodies, smooth jazz offers a sophisticated listening experience that has captivated audiences worldwide.
The Essence of Smooth Jazz
Unlike traditional jazz, which often focuses on complex improvisation, smooth jazz prioritizes melodic flow and atmospheric soundscapes. The genre is defined by:
Soulful saxophones – A signature element, with artists like Kenny G and David Sanborn making the instrument a staple of the genre.
Electric keyboards and soft guitar riffs – Creating a warm and inviting sonic texture.
Slow to mid-tempo grooves – Offering a relaxed and easy-listening experience.
Polished production – Resulting in a smooth and refined sound that’s perfect for any occasion.
Pioneers and Iconic Artists
Smooth jazz has been shaped by legendary musicians, including:
George Benson – A virtuoso guitarist known for his fluid and melodic style.
Kenny G – One of the most recognizable names in smooth jazz, with his signature soprano saxophone sound.
David Sanborn – A master saxophonist blending jazz, pop, and R&B influences.
Najee – A multi-instrumentalist who brought a fresh and modern touch to the genre.
These artists, among many others, have helped define the genre and bring it to mainstream audiences.

The Enduring Appeal of Smooth Jazz
One of the reasons smooth jazz remains popular is its versatility. It’s frequently played in cafes, hotel lounges, and upscale restaurants, creating an ambiance of sophistication and relaxation. The genre's crossover appeal has also led to collaborations with pop and R&B artists, keeping the sound fresh and relevant.
